/*
|
||
|
|
* @ingroup hct_spi
|
||
|
|
* @brief Initializes the SPI module.
|
||
|
|
*
|
||
|
|
* @par Description:
|
||
|
|
* Initializes the SPI module.
|
||
|
|
*
|
||
|
|
* @attention To initialize the SPI module, the user needs to perform the initial configuration on the SPI information
|
||
|
|
* as follows:
|
||
|
|
* @li Clear p_spi_ctrl to 0.
|
||
|
|
* @li Specify the number of used hardware devices, that is, assign a value to g_test_spi_ctrl.hw_device_count.
|
||
|
|
* @li Specify the hardware resource space to be used, that is, assign a value to g_test_spi_ctrl.p_hw_devs.
|
||
|
|
* The parameter p_hw_devs points to the ext_spi_hw_dev_s array space.
|
||
|
|
* @li Specify the number of software handles (maximum number of concurrent callers), that is,
|
||
|
|
* assign a value to g_test_spi_ctrl.sw_device_count.
|
||
|
|
* @li Specify the software handle space, that is, assign a value to g_test_spi_ctrl.p_sw_devs.
|
||
|
|
* The parameter p_sw_devs points to the ext_spi_sw_dev_s array space.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the base address of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].reg_base.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the interrupt ID of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].irq_num.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the buffer type of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].data_width_byte.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the size of the TX buffer of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].tx_buf.total_len, which indicates the size of the TX buffer.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the TX buffer space of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].tx_buf.p_buf. The TX buffer space is provided by the user. The TX buffer size is equal
|
||
|
|
* to tx_buf.total_len*data_width_byte. When data_width_byte is EXT_SPI_SOFT_BUF_DATA_WIDTH_2_BYTES,
|
||
|
|
* the space address needs to be 2-byte aligned.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the RX buffer size of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].rx_buf.total_len, which indicates the size of the RX buffer.
|
||
|
|
* @li Configure the RX buffer space of the nth hardware resource, that is, assign a value to
|
||
|
|
* g_test_spi_hw_device[n].rx_buf.p_buf. The RX buffer space is provided by the user. The RX buffer size is equal to
|
||
|
|
* rx_buf.total_len*data_width_byte. When data_width_byte is EXT_SPI_SOFT_BUF_DATA_WIDTH_2_BYTES, the space
|
||
|
|
* address needs to be 2-byte aligned.
|
||
|
|
* @param p_spi_ctrl [IN] Type #ext_spi_ctrl_s, global resource used by the SPI module. The space
|
||
|
|
* is provided by the user and cannot be released.
|
||
|
|
*
|
||
|
|
* @retval #0 Success
|
||
|
|
* @retval #Other values Failure. For details, see soc_errno.h.
|
||
|
|
* @par Dependency:
|
||
|
|
* @li soc_mdm_spi.h: This file describes the SPI APIs.
|
||
|
|
* @see None
|
||
|
|
* @since DW21_V100R001C00
|
||
|
|
*/
|
||
|
|
EXT_EXTERN td_u32 uapi_spi_init(ext_spi_ctrl_s *p_spi_ctrl);
